Chapter 9: General Concepts
9-1. Definitions 9-2. Systems with Stochastic Inputs 9-3. The Power Spectrum
Chapter 10: Random Walks and Other Applications
10-1. Random Walks and Brownian Motion 10-3. Modulation 10-4. Cyclostationary Processes
Chapter 11: Spectral Representation
11-1. Regular Processes, Factorization and Innovation 11-2. AR, MA, and ARMA processes 11-3.. Fourier Series and Karhunen-Loeve Expansions 11-4. Wold Decomposition
Chapter 12: Spectrum Estimation
12-1. Ergodicity 12-2. Spectrum Estimation (Data/Spectral Windows) 12-3. Lattice Filter, Levinson's Algorithm, System Identification of AR/MA/ARMA Processes
Chapter 13: Mean Square Estimation
13-1. Introduction, Orthogonality Principle 13-2. Prediction, Wiener-Hopf Equation, Proof of Wold Decomposition 13-3. Prediction and Filtering
